How they compare

(SDGRC) ECA_EAC currently reports 6.60 million against 316 in Switzerland, a difference of 6.60 million.

Across all 5 years both countries report, (SDGRC) ECA_EAC has been ahead every year.

(SDGRC) ECA_EAC ranks 85th and Switzerland ranks 84th of 148 groups.
